The report highlighted new powers in Tennessee,which lately handed a legislation – dubbed the Elvis Act – to ban the usage of AI to mimic an artist’s voice without their authorization.

The MPs said this example“confirmed the case which the United kingdom should introduce a identity appropriate to protect the individuality of creators in the united kingdom and not drop at the rear of our Worldwide competition”.

The UK does already have existing protections” that prevent a single human being from misrepresenting Yet another human being when providing items or products and services.

Nevertheless, the MPs mentioned it was but “to get viewed if This may be helpful versus deepfakes”.

They included: “Unambiguous laws that safeguards creators and artists from misappropriation and Fake endorsement would provide clarity and certainty for all concerned, including tech vendors.”

They said a “pro-creative industries AI Bill”should also involve a ideal for musicians to forestall their operate being used by AI, apparent labelling of audio produced with AI, the generation of an international taskforce, and copyright reforms.

A governing administration spokesperson explained: “We are devoted to helping artists plus the Imaginative industries work Along with the AI sector to harness the possibilities this technological know-how offers, and guarantee our new music can carry on for being savored around the world.

“Trust and transparency are vital to this shared approach. We are Functioning closely with stakeholders and will provide a further update in due course.”
